One of the main goal of the Department of Education is building partnership through collaboration. Diaz Elementary school, a multi-grade school intended for the Aeta children situated at the highest peak mountains of Porac, and a satellite school then of Villa Maria Integrated School.
The school has no source of electricity considering the distance from the town proper, and the up and down terrain of the road going to the school. Following the mission of the department, as steward of learning and ensure an enabling and supportive environment for effective learning to happen, and a leader that nurture learners, partners were contact and made through outreach programs.
The One Meralco Foundation Inc. then, got an eye of the present situation of the said school.
The school head and the representative of One Meralco Foundation, Rainier R. Manguat met and agreed on the conditions and requirements set by the non-government entity, with the presence of the District Supervisor then of Porac East, Mr. Teodulo P. Esguerra Jr. at the office of the Schools Division Superintendent, Officer-In-Charge, Leonardo D. Zapanta, Ed. D., CESO VI of the Division of Pampanga.
A seven hundred thousand pesos worth of solar powered equipment be placed to the elementary school of barangay Diaz Porac. An initial meeting with the barangay chieftain as well as the PTA officers and learners were given orientation about the program.
It takes one to two months spend due to weather conditions to light-up the whole school. The project was inaugurated and turn over to the people of Diaz during the birthday of the Chairman of Meralco, Manuel V. Pangilinan, with the presence of the Municipal Executives of Porac, Pampanga. Pupils were interviewed then on the importance of electricity in the barangay.
The school is the 100th recipient Solar Powered Electricity of the Foundation, the only solar powered school in the Division of Pampanga and it serves now as the charging station, light source of the community. The school was also recipient of one LED TV, three stand fans, three-in-one printer for educational purposes.
Now, the small ayta community is enjoying the privileged given by One Meralco Foundation keeping the banner “Sa Meralco may liwanag ang buhay.” As of this moment, the community was given electrical line from Pampanga Electric Cooperative II through the effort of their incumbent Barangay Captain.
